What multi-agent orchestration actually is.

Most teams already have capable models. What they do not have is the layer that governs them. Orchestration is not one assistant with more tools. It is the set of decisions made every time work moves through your business.

  • 01
    Which agent takes the work

    Routed by capability, cost, and the context the task actually needs, not by whichever window happened to be open.

  • 02
    What it is allowed to touch

    Scoped access per agent and per system, so a research task cannot reach the systems that move money.

  • 03
    When a human decides

    Approval gates on anything consequential. The system prepares the decision and waits for a person to make it.

  • 04
    What happened, and why

    Every action carries its evidence, so the record answers the audit question before anyone has to ask it.

A worked example

One opportunity, from inbound to committee.

This is a single deal moving through a system we deployed. Nothing here is a model answering a question. Every step is scoped work with a named owner, and the two decisions that matter still belong to a person.

  1. TriggerRuns automatically

    A deck lands in the shared inbox

    The opportunity is created, the sender matched against prior contact, and anything already known about the company is attached before anyone opens it.

  2. Research agentRuns automatically

    Background assembled

    Market, competitors, team history, and prior coverage pulled together, with every claim linked back to the source it came from.

  3. Analysis agentRuns automatically

    Scored against your thesis

    Checked against the criteria your firm actually uses, with the mismatches stated plainly rather than buried at the end of a summary.

  4. YouWaits for your decision

    Pursue, or pass

    The system has prepared the decision and stops. Pass, and it writes the reason to the record. Pursue, and the next stage begins on its own.

  5. OttoRuns automatically

    Diligence tracked and chased

    Outstanding requests monitored against the data room, owners chased when items go quiet, and what was promised reconciled against what actually arrived.

  6. OttoRuns automatically

    The committee pack, written

    Drafted in your format, from your own materials, with the open questions and the evidence behind each one attached.

  7. CommitteeWaits for your decision

    The decision, made by people

    The judgement was always yours. What changed is that it arrives prepared, on time, and with the work behind it already done.

Swap the trigger and the criteria and the same shape covers a renewal, a claim, an onboarding, or a compliance review.
